1977 · 42 min · Documentary

A funny chronicle of the São Paulo middle class in the 1970s, based on a simple but effective premise: a primary school class meeting, 20 years later. Retrato de Classe starts from a photo of the junior class of a private school, in a middle class neighborhood of São Paulo. He searches for and gathers former colleagues and a teacher, in order to recreate the group's trajectories, to draw the profile of the country's metropolitan bourgeoisie. A country in crisis and a middle class that was experiencing the collapse of the economic miracle. Frustrations, desires, prejudice and futility are part of this universe of people and their life trajectories.

Directed by Gregório Bacic · Written by Fernando Pacheco Jordão
